Income Tax 1099G Information - Unemployment Insurance Claimants

 

Form 1099-G, Statement for Recipients of Certain Government Payments, is issued to any individual who received Maryland Unemployment Insurance (UI) benefits for the prior calendar year. 1099-Gs reflect Maryland UI benefit payment amounts issued  within that calendar year. This may be different from the week ending date for which the benefits were paid.

1099-Gs are required, by law, to be mailed by the end of January (January 31st) for the prior calendar year.

1099-Gs are only issued to the actual individual to whom benefits were paid. If you have moved since filing for UI benefits, 1099-Gs are NOT forwarded by the United States Postal Service. Will I receive a 1099-G from DLLR for Unemployment Insurance I received last year or prior years?
If you received unemployment insurance benefits during any calendar year ending 12/31, you will receive a 1099G for that year only. It will be mailed before or by January 31 of the following year.

Does UI benefit information need to be reported for Federal and State income taxes?
Yes, the Tax Reform Act of 1986 mandated that unemployment insurance benefits are taxable.

Do I need the 1099-G form to file my taxes?
Yes, you need the 1099-G form. The form you receive will be a three-part form. Copy A is for Federal Income Tax return. Copy B is for State Income tax return. Copy C is for your records.

If I repaid benefits that I had received, will I receive a 1099-G?
If you received UI benefits in the same year during which you repaid an overpayment of benefits, you will receive a 1099-G for that year. If you only repaid benefits received from prior benefit years, you will not receive a 1099-G.
